Home Uncategorized Doctor Who Extra – Robot of Sherwood Uncategorized Doctor Who Extra – Robot of Sherwood By Cameron K. McEwan - 06/09/2014 FacebookTwitterPinterestWhatsApp In the player above you can watch Doctor Who Extra Episode 3 – Robot of Sherwood. For more clips, pics and info from the story, click HERE. Share this:Click to share on Twitter (Opens in new window)Click to share on Facebook (Opens in new window)Like this:Like Loading... Related RELATED ARTICLESMORE FROM AUTHOR Video of the Day – Friday Night With Jonathan Ross, 2023 Video of the Day – Corner Office: Official Trailer, 2023 Video of the Day – Times Radio, 2023 LEAVE A REPLY Cancel reply Please enter your comment! Please enter your name here You have entered an incorrect email address! Please enter your email address here Save my name, email, and website in this browser for the next time I comment. Notify me of follow-up comments by email. Notify me of new posts by email. Δ This site uses Akismet to reduce spam. Learn how your comment data is processed.